Tiffany Haddish reveals she once donated eggs: 'Might got some kids out here'


Tiffany Haddish says she may have kids in the world she has never met.
The actress recently divulged that she donated her eggs back in her early 20s when she needed extra money. The comedian, who is now dating
Common, also said she is open to adoption.
“I don’t wanna pay nobody to carry my baby neither, ’cause then I have to go through a process of giving myself injections and all that stuff,” the comedian said about surrogacy while speaking on E!’s 
Daily Pop. “And I already gave up — here goes something everybody don’t know, I’m gonna tell you: When I was 21, I was really hard up for some money and I gave up a bunch of eggs.”

Tiffany Haddish has gotten candid about her desire to start a family. In a new interview, the "
Girls Trip" star declared that she prefers adopting to going through surrogacy, before revealing the real reason why she is not interested in having a surrogate mother carry her baby for her.
Making a virtual appearance on the Monday, May 3 episode of E!'s Daily Pop, the 41-year-old confessed that she is currently enrolled in some parenting classes. "I'm taking parenting classes now to adopt," she explained. "I'm looking at, you know, 5 and up - really like 7. I want them to be able to know how to use the restroom on their own and talk. I want them to know that I put in the work and I wanted them."

Tiffany Haddish fought back tears on the set of her TV show "
Kids Say the Darndest Things" after learning she had won her first Grammy Award in the middle of a taping.
The "
Girls Trip" star landed the Best Comedy Album for her "
Black Mitzvah" stand-up special on Netflix, but she was unable to attend the Los Angeles prizegiving on Sunday (14Mar21) as she was already booked to take on hosting duties for her TV comedy series.

The "
Girls Trip" star will take on the lead role as Trine, a Los Angeles street psychic who has no memory of her own identity or background, but somehow knows all the secrets of everyone else.
She is recruited by a desperate police officer to help solve a case, only for the pair to be framed for murder themselves.

CBS is reviving the variety series “Kids Say the Darndest Things” with Tiffany Haddish, some six months after ABC canceled
their revival of the classic series after only 1 season.
Haddish will continue in her role as host and executive producer. It will premiere sometime during the current 2020-21 season.
For CBS, the network is touting the move to CBS as a homecoming for the long-running format. It originated as a segment on the CBS Radio show “House Party” by Art Linkletter in 1945. He made it a regular segment between 1952-1969. CBS then made it a TV series hosted by Bill Cosby from 1998-2000.
